Felipe Melo recusa “clubismo” na Globo e cita gratidão pelo Flamengo: “Não posso deixar de elogiar”

Felipe Melo, em participação no Fechamento SporTV (Reprodução)

Contratado pela Rede Globo, Felipe Melo não teve dúvidas ao iniciar uma trajetória na mídia esportiva. Apesar do carinho envolvendo Palmeiras e Fluminense, o ex-jogador descarta qualquer tipo clubismo nos comentários veiculados para os torcedores. Mesmo sem uma identificação extrema, o período atuando no Flamengo também é valorizado, motivo pelo qual o Rubro-Negro nunca será alvo de deboche ou comentários injustos.

“Eu não tenho clubismo, tenho uma preferência de clubes. Fluminense e Palmeiras são os dois clubes que eu amo no Brasil. E tem outros clubes que eu passei, como o Flamengo, que eu tenho uma gratidão enorme.”, disse Felipe Melo, em entrevista ao Podpah.

“Joguei e fui campeão da tríplice coroa no Cruzeiro. Fiquei só três meses no Grêmio, mas conheci minha esposa em Porto Alegre. Eu tenho gratidão por esses clubes, mas não posso ser clubista.”, acrescentou.

Felipe Melo enfatiza vitória do Flamengo

Fora de casa, o Flamengo teve competência para triunfar diante do Palmeiras. Recordando a primeira “final” do Brasileirão, Felipe Melo deixou claro que nunca iria desmerecer o resultado apenas para privilegiar o carinho atrelado ao time alviverde. Por conta disso, o desempenho da equipe de Filipe Luís ganhou elogios no pós-jogo.

“Eu não posso deixar de elogiar o Flamengo, que ganhou do Palmeiras. Não dá! É a transparência. Tem que tomar cuidado com situações assim. De fato, eu tenho sido muito ajudado pelos meus colegas.”, prosseguiu.

Responsabilidade total para não cometer erros

Acumulando momentos explosivos durante a carreira, Felipe Melo tem adotado um discurso mais ponderado desde que se afastou dos gramados. Neste cenário, ex-volante tem evitado polêmicas diretas e optado por uma abordagem reflexiva. Sem citar nomes específicos, ele fez críticas direcionadas a certas personalidades da mídia esportiva que acabam disseminando opiniões levianas e mal fundamentadas.

“Eu gosto muito de elogiar. Se você critica, tem que elogiar. Eu tomo muito cuidado porque a única coisa que eu jamais vou fazer é ferir a honra de qualquer atleta. Antes do atleta tem o pai, filho, irmão, marido… não dá para ferir a honra como muitos fazem. Falam que é personagem. É um personagem que faz o pai, o filho e a esposa chorarem. Acho que não deveria existir no mundo do jornalismo.”, externou.
